New team members: our search relevance tuning notes live in a locked archive tied to the service account, not personal logins. If that account is lost or deactivated, relevance experiments cannot be replayed, so recovery matters. First, confirm the account's last good snapshot in the admin panel, then request a recovery session from the on-call lead. The session opens a one-time console where historical boost weights can be restored. To authenticate the console, enter the passphrase below.

unlock words, bahop-fawef: novmir-druwyn-soriel-rusdor-kasion

## Onboarding: Fareweight Rules Engine

Fareweight computes shipping fees from stacked rule sets. Rules are versioned; never edit a live version. Deploys go through the staging evaluator first. Read the rule DSL guide before touching anything.

Rule definitions live in the pricing database — connect to it with the connection string below.

primary connection of yagep-bajop = postgresql://druiel_svc:gW@db-3860.sivrelworks.example:5432/brieth

## Onboarding: Parityscope Plugin Signing

External plugins for Parityscope, our hotel rate-parity checker, must be signed before the scanner will load them. Your plugin should declare the channels it compares and never cache fetched rates longer than ten minutes. After your manifest passes validation, sign the package using the sandbox deploy key provided below.

release key, tajep-tahaf: bky19_d9NV5NtNvNNQVVKBK4P

Subject: DR drill next Thursday — Lattice component library

Hey Priya,

Quick heads-up: the disaster-recovery drill will simulate losing the Lattice registry, so we'll restore versions 4.x from the cold mirror. Please freeze releases that morning. To unlock the restore tooling during the drill, you'll need the recovery passphrase noted below.

strongbox words: norwyn-wenael-aldvan-aldiel-wendor-holael